StaySea Bee

Harriet Island regional park is always a great place to enjoy a relaxing stroll with the dogs. There are also many amenities available for all types of activities. They have barbecue grills, picnic tables, tons of green space to fly a kite or a game of frisbee. There is a well maintained playground for the kids too. The bike/walking trail runs through here. You can get just about anywhere in the metro on that trail. The paddleboats take off from here on wonderful river rides. They have midday rides that anyone can afford. As well as beautiful sunset rides for a romantic evening. We are all very lucky to have such a nice place right in the middle of our city.
